I joined an Influenster campaign because it stated I’d receive a 30 ml product.
The campaign required me to show my face in the content, which I usually avoid, but I accepted because I genuinely like the brand and thought the full-size product made it worthwhile.
Instead, I received a 5 ml sample.
There was no mention anywhere that participants would receive a sample instead of the advertised size.
I contacted Influenster, and they replied that it’s normal for some campaigns to send samples and that I should focus on reviewing the product regardless of the quantity.
I understand that some campaigns use samples, but shouldn’t that be disclosed upfront?
I still plan to complete the campaign because I keep my word, but I feel the lack of transparency is unfair.
Am I overreacting? Has this happened to anyone else?
